首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

当前时间选择器与时间选择器时间Android告警的时间差

是指在Android系统中,当用户使用时间选择器选择一个时间后,与当前系统时间之间的差异。这个差异可以用来触发一些告警或提醒功能,比如在用户选择的时间到达时发送通知。

在Android中,可以使用系统提供的DatePicker和TimePicker控件来实现时间选择器。用户可以通过这些控件选择日期和时间。当用户选择完时间后,可以通过获取当前系统时间和用户选择的时间进行比较,计算出时间差。

时间差的计算可以使用Java中的日期和时间相关的类库,比如java.util.Date和java.util.Calendar。通过获取当前系统时间和用户选择的时间,可以得到它们之间的毫秒数差值。然后可以根据需求将毫秒数转换为分钟、小时或其他时间单位。

在Android中,可以使用AlarmManager来触发告警或提醒功能。可以通过设置AlarmManager的触发时间为当前系统时间加上时间差,当时间到达时,系统会触发相应的操作,比如发送通知或执行某个任务。

对于时间选择器与时间差的应用场景,一个常见的例子是提醒用户在指定时间进行某个重要的任务,比如提醒用户按时服药、提醒用户参加会议等。

腾讯云提供了一系列与时间相关的产品和服务,比如云服务器、云函数、消息队列等,可以用来支持时间选择器与时间差的功能实现。具体的产品介绍和相关链接可以参考腾讯云官方网站的文档和产品页面。

请注意,本回答仅供参考,具体实现方式和产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Flutter 时间选择器

DateType 对应我们上图四种样式 YM , YMD_HM ,YMD_AP_HM kYMD 这四种 还需传入 最大时间和最小时间 DateTime maxValue, DateTime minValue...clickCallback(timeStr,picker.adapter.text); } ); 我们在 DateTimePickerAdapter 适配器总传入我们从外部传入参数以及获取到当前时间...DateTime.now(), 我们在 callback 回调方法中 通过picker.adapter 获取到适配器里面的属性value 拿到当前选择时间 var time = (picker.adapter...time); showText(str); } ); } } 到此我们时间选择器和底部选择器单列多列就算讲完了...最后总结: flutter里面提供比较好用 flutter_picker: 1.1.5 date_format: 1.0.8 底部选择器时间转换库 供我们调用 所以底部弹窗实现 这里也要感谢作者共享

1.8K20
  • 时间选择器TimePickerDialog

    TimePickerDialog是一个android自带为设置时间而提供Dialog,使用起来简单,上手快。时常配合Canlendar一起使用。 ?...时间选择器 Canlendar:   Canlendar是日历类,它是一个单例类,通过Canlendar c=Canlendar.getInstance();实例化后,变可以获得年月日时分秒等。...而在实例化时候变获取了当前系统时间。同样可以根据c.set。。()方法对它属性进行设置。   ...日历对象还有一个重要方法是setTimeInMillis,该方法只有一个参数,即距离1970年1月1日0时毫秒数,调用这个方法,则会根据你传入毫秒数对日历对象中变量进行相应设置,如果想设置为当前系统时间...activity指针;第二个参数是一个监听,它监听是当时间设置完成后回调,返回参数有view、设置hour、设置minute;第三个参数(hour)和第四个参数(minute)为弹出时间对话框初始显示小时和分钟

    2.2K20

    python下日期时间时间格式转换、时间戳处理,时间差处理)

    python下日期时间 一、在Python中,时间主要有三种表示形式, 1.时间戳(TimeStamp):1970年1月1日之后秒 2.时间元组格式化形式 包含了:年、日、星期 得到...(0-6),星期天为星期开始 %W 一年中星期数(00-53)星期一为星期开始 %x 本地相应日期表示 %X 本地相应时间表示 %Z 当前时区名称 %% %号本身 二、三种时间转化 1.时间戳...#用time.localtime()方法,将一个时间戳转换为当前时区struct_time。...#根据时间戳来计算(注意时间戳时秒还是毫秒) #1、天数 time.time()+86400*7 #当前时间后7天 #2、小时 time.time()+3600*7 #当前时间后7小时 #3...、分钟 time.time()+60*7 #当前时间后7分钟 1542766334.2900052 三、字符串形式计算时间差 #字符串时间差 import datetime start ="2018

    13.8K30

    日期选择器DatePicker和时间选择器TimePicker

    在实际开发中,经常会遇见一些时间选择器、日期选择器、数字选择器等需求,那么从本期开始来学习Android中常用选择器,今天学习是DatePicker和TimePicker。...android:endYear:设置日期选择器允许选择最后一年。 android:maxDate:设置该日期选择器最大日期。以mm/dd/yyyy格式指定最大日期。...android:startYear:设置日期选择器允许选择第一年。 接下来通过一个简单示例程序来学习DatePicker使用。...二、TimePicker TimePickerDatePicker非常相似,主要是供用户选择时间。...也是在FrameLayout基础上提供了一些方法来获取当前用户所选择时间,如果程序需要获取用户选择时间则可通过为TimePicker添加 OnTimeChangedListener 进行监听来实现

    4.9K50

    laydate插件实现时间选择器

    文章目录 一、前言: 二、年选择器: 1、引入js和css文件: 2、写一个input标签: 3、执行一个laydate实例 4、页面效果: 三、年月选择器 1、替换type属性 2、页面效果:...四、碰到bug及解决方案 1、每次都会有上次输入痕迹,影响第二次输入 2、实现点击即选中 一、前言: layDate 在 layui 2.0 版本中迎来一次重生。...全面重写 layDate 包含了大量更新,其中主要以:年选择器、年月选择器、日期选择器时间选择器、日期时间选择器 五种类型选择方式为基本核心,并且均支持范围选择(即双控件)。...内置强劲自定义日期格式解析和合法校正机制,含中文版和国际版,主题简约却又不失灵活多样。由于内部采用是零依赖原生 JavaScript 编写,因此又可作为独立组件使用。...毫无疑问,这是 layui 虔心之作 以上来自layui官网 二、年选择器: 1、引入js和css文件: <!

    2.2K20
    领券